Seniors who need a little help around the house this Holiday Season, can call “Santa’s Helpers for Seniors.” To share the Joy of the Season, Comfort Keepers is offering a free visit from a Santa helper. Comfort Keepers will stop by to help with making a holiday meal, pick up food at the store, help address envelops and mail, get you to a doctor's appointment, help decorate your home, bake some goodies or straighten up your home for visiting family. Any needy senior without help otherwise is welcome to call. Just call 921-4747 to speak with Santa and mention the Santa Helpers for Seniors. Help is available through Dec. 20.
2. Make plans to be downtown this weekend for the 16th annual Winter Wonderland. The family-friendly festivities begin Saturday at 5 p.m. along Old Main Street. The event’s signature attraction, snow sledding mountains, will be in the parking lot north of Old Main Pub. A parade departs from the south end of Old Main Street around 6 p.m. to escort Mr. and Mrs. Santa Claus to the entrance of Westminster Courtyard, 222 Old Main St., where they will meet with visitors until about 8:30 p.m. Bradenton Yacht Club’s 14th Annual Holiday Boat Parade, which begins at 6:30 p.m. Saturday, is expected to pass the downtown waterfront around 8:30 p.m.
